Bread and Circuses<p>Any impartial observer can easily see that we are in a planetary climate emergency. The only people who continue to deny it are capitalists, fascists, and those who support them. <br>________________________________</p><p>The surge in ocean temperatures to record-breaking levels in 2023 and 2024 is a sign that the pace of climate change has accelerated, say researchers.</p><p>Global ocean temperatures hit record highs for 450 days straight in 2023 and early 2024. Although some of the extra heat can be explained by an El Niño weather pattern emerging in the Pacific Ocean, about 44% of the record warmth is due to the world’s oceans absorbing heat from the sun at an accelerating rate, according to Chris Merchant at the University of Reading, UK.</p><p>Merchant and his colleagues used satellite data to analyse ocean warming over the past four decades, concluding that the rate of warming has more than quadrupled since 1985.</p><p>The team says this rapid acceleration is down to a sharp change in Earth’s energy imbalance (EEI), a measure of how much heat is being trapped in the atmosphere. EEI has roughly doubled since 2010, causing the oceans to soak up much more heat now than they used to.</p><p>Based on their analysis, Merchant and his team predict that the rate of ocean warming could continue to increase rapidly in the coming decades. “If the EEI trend extrapolates into the future, then we can expect as much warming in the next 20 years as we have had in the last 40 years, which is quite a marked acceleration,” says Merchant.<br>________________________________</p><p>FULL STORY -- <a href="https://www.newscientist.com/article/2465689-surge-in-ocean-heat-is-a-sign-climate-change-is-accelerating/"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">newscientist.com/article/24656</span><span class="invisible">89-surge-in-ocean-heat-is-a-sign-climate-change-is-accelerating/</span></a></p><p><a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Science"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Science</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Environment"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Environment</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Climate"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Climate</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ateChange"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ateChange</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ateCrisis"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ateCrisis</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ateEmergency"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ateEmergency</span></a></p>

Bread and Circuses<p>Concluding excerpts from the transcript of an important talk on “The Tipping Points of Climate Change” given recently by climate scientist Johan Rockström. <br>🧵4/4<br>________________________________</p><p>To summarize, there is no 1.5 degrees Celsius delivery on the Paris Agreement by only phasing out fossil fuels. We also need to come back into the safe operating space of nature-based biodiversity, all the planetary boundaries of nature.</p><p>And we have the solutions. We know that solving the planet crisis is not utopia. It's not fantasy. We have the solutions for a secure, stable future for humanity.</p><p>What are those transformations? It's a rapid transition away from fossil fuels. It is a transition towards circular business models. It is transitioning towards healthy diets from sustainable food systems. And it's not only halting loss of nature, it's also scaling the regeneration and restoration of marine systems, soils, forests and wetlands. </p><p>Now I was nervous already in 2020 when we entered this decisive decade and had to cut global emissions by half by 2030. Halfway into this decade, the road is steeper than ever. It's steeper than ever. This is what really, really concerns us. That we have a situation where we now need to move so fast. <br>________________________________</p><p>We know the answers. We know the crucial choice that must be made. It’s time now to turn away from capitalism, from economic exploitation and social injustice. We need system change. </p><p>FULL PRESENTATION ▶️ <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EfQ"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Ef</span><span class="invisible">Q</span></a></p><p><a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Science"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Science</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Environment"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Environment</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Climate"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Climate</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ateChange"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ateChange</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ateCrisis"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ateCrisis</span></a></p>
Bread and Circuses<p>More excerpts from the transcript of a talk on “The Tipping Points of Climate Change” given by climate scientist Johan Rockström. <br>🧵3/4<br>_______________________________</p><p>We are now at a point where we are forced to ask the following question: Are we at risk of pushing the planet out of where we’ve been since we left the last Ice Age, the extraordinarily stable Holocene state?</p><p>If we pushed ourselves outside, drifting away unstoppably towards a hothouse Earth where we get self-amplified warming and losing life support on Earth, what could take us there? [First graphic below]</p><p>If we cross tipping points — big systems like the Greenland ice sheet, the overturning of heat in the North Atlantic, the coral reef systems, the Amazon rainforest, and others — push these systems too far, and they will flip over from a desired state that helps us,<br>to a state that will self-amplify in the wrong direction, going from cooling and dampening to self-amplifying and warming. </p><p>The health of the planet must be kept intact. We must have a planet that crosses no tipping points. That is why we need planetary boundaries, the boundary framework that defines the nine Earth system processes that regulates the stability and resilience of the entire planet: climate, biodiversity, nitrogen, phosphorus, land, fresh water, air pollutants and chemicals. That is the challenge. </p><p>[Second graphic] What shall we do to avoid these unmanageable outcomes? Well, the IPCC is clear on the pathway. To stay under 1.5 degrees Celsius, to avoid crossing tipping points, we need to operate within the global carbon budget that gives us a chance of holding at 1.5.</p><p>What remains for us is only 200 billion tons of carbon dioxide that we can continue emitting to have a 50 percent chance of holding at 1.5. We emit today 40 billion tons of carbon dioxide per year, giving us five years at current rates of emission before we've consumed the budget. We are seriously running out of time. <br>_______________________________</p><p>Part four will follow soon. </p><p>FULL PRESENTATION ▶️ <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EfQ"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Ef</span><span class="invisible">Q</span></a></p><p><a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Science"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Science</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Environment"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Environment</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Climate"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Climate</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ateChange"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ateChange</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ateCrisis"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ateCrisis</span></a></p>
Bread and Circuses<p>Here is another excerpt from the transcript of an important talk on “The Tipping Points of Climate Change” given by climate scientist Johan Rockström. <br>🧵2/4<br>___________________________</p><p>But it's not only carbon dioxide. Any parameter that matters for human well-being and our economies looks the same. [First graphic below]</p><p>Here you have it, linear change up until the 1950s, then we go into the great acceleration. And this is what we're seeing across overconsumption of fresh water, the sixth mass extinction of species, over-putrefying our freshwater systems with nitrogen and phosphorus, all of it undermining the stability of the planet.</p><p>We are seeing that this is now causing impacts everywhere. We're seeing bigger and bigger invoices being sent by the Earth system onto societies across the entire world, in droughts, floods, disease patterns, heat waves, and huge storms, scientifically attributed to human-caused climate change. </p><p>[Second graphic] We've had a 10,000-year period where our civilizations have developed, where we've had the enormous privilege of a planet at 14 degrees Celsius, plus or minus 0.5 degrees Celsius. That's the Holocene since we left the last ice age. </p><p>If you look three million years back, we never exceeded two degrees Celsius. That's the warmest temperature on Earth during the entire Quaternary. I call this the “corridor of life.” Is it surprising that we scientists are getting really, really nervous? <br>___________________________</p><p>Part three will follow soon. </p><p>FULL PRESENTATION ▶️ <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EfQ"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Ef</span><span class="invisible">Q</span></a></p><p><a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Science"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Science</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Environment"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Environment</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Climate"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Climate</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ateChange"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ateChange</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ateCrisis"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ateCrisis</span></a></p>
Bread and Circuses<p>Johan Rockström is an internationally recognized scientist who leads development of the planetary boundaries framework, first published in 2009 and updated in 2015 and 2023. (See <a href="https://www.stockholmresilience.org/research/planetary-boundaries.html"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">stockholmresilience.org/resear</span><span class="invisible">ch/planetary-boundaries.html</span></a>)</p><p>Last month, Rockström gave an important talk on “The Tipping Points of Climate Change.” He began his presentation with these ominous words…<br>_______________________________</p><p>We Earth system scientists and climate scientists are getting seriously nervous. The planet is changing faster than we expected. We are, despite years of raising the alarm, now seeing that the planet is actually in a situation where we underestimated risks. Abrupt changes are occurring in a way that is far beyond the realistic expectations in science. </p><p>What worries us most is this: we are starting to see an *acceleration* of warming over the past 50 years. It was 0.18 degrees Celsius per decade from 1970 to 2010, but then from 2014 onwards, it abruptly jumps up to 0.26 per decade. </p><p>If we follow this path, we will crash through two degrees Celsius within 20 years and hit three degrees Celsius by the year 2100, a disastrous outcome.<br>_______________________________</p><p>In the images below (slides from the talk), you can plainly see the acceleration of warming that has Rockström and other scientists so worried.</p><p>I’ll post more from this talk in a few minutes. 🧵1/4</p><p>FULL PRESENTATION ▶️ <a href="https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EfQ"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://www.</span><span class="ellipsis">youtube.com/watch?v=Vl6VhCAeEf</span><span class="invisible">Q</span></a></p><p><a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Science"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Science</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Environment"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Environment</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/Climate"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Climate</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ateChange"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ateChange</span></a> <a href="https://climatejustice.social/tags/ClimateCrisis"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>ClimateCrisis</span></a></p>
